Mostly works to add more detail, without altering the result too much.
Something changes. Often, the composition will be a little different. I have used a small dataset with vibrant colours and detail.
Results from this model tend to be more detailed and colorful, especially on portraits, with a weight of roughly 0.8. Adds a slight fantasy feel. Too much appears to blur the image with unnecessary details.
Experimental! I am still figuring out what it can do. Use with care at higher weights.
I've simply used FLUX images that I like and put them in a dataset. Works better for portraits. This LoRA is trained on dev-fp8.
